Preparing for Removal


Caution - Caution -

Do not attempt to remove the Solaris Resource Manager files manually. You would have trouble reinstalling the software later and could end up with an unusable system.


Before you remove any of the Solaris Resource Manager software, make a backup of the Solaris Resource Manager database file, /var/srm/srmDB. This is particularly important if you plan to use this product again. If you lose this file, you will have to rebuild your Solaris Resource Manager database from scratch. You may also want to back up the database if the information in it is important to you.

See "Managing Lnodes" in Solaris Resource Manager 1.3 System Administration Guide for instructions on how to save and restore the /var/srm/srmDB database.
